Les bases : Que sont les CMC et les PAC ?<\/h2>\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<div class=\"elementor-element elementor-element-def7507 elementor-widget elementor-widget-heading\" data-id=\"def7507\" data-element_type=\"widget\" data-settings=\"{&quot;ekit_we_effect_on&quot;:&quot;none&quot;}\" data-widget_type=\"heading.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t<h3 class=\"elementor-heading-title elementor-size-default\">1.CMC<\/h3>\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<div class=\"elementor-element elementor-element-61fa286 elementor-widget elementor-widget-text-editor\" data-id=\"61fa286\" data-element_type=\"widget\" data-settings=\"{&quot;ekit_we_effect_on&quot;:&quot;none&quot;}\" data-widget_type=\"text-editor.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t\t\t\t\t<p><b>CMC, ou cellulose carboxym\u00e9thylique<\/b>est l'un des d\u00e9riv\u00e9s de la cellulose les plus courants. Il est obtenu en traitant la cellulose (provenant de la pulpe de coton ou de bois) avec un alcali et de l'acide monochlorac\u00e9tique, ce qui introduit des groupes carboxym\u00e9thyles (-CH\u2082COOH) dans la cha\u00eene de cellulose.<\/p>\t\t\t\t\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<div class=\"elementor-element elementor-element-c99f544 elementor-widget elementor-widget-text-editor\" data-id=\"c99f544\" data-element_type=\"widget\" data-settings=\"{&quot;ekit_we_effect_on&quot;:&quot;none&quot;}\" data-widget_type=\"text-editor.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t\t\t\t\t<p>Le r\u00e9sultat ? Un polym\u00e8re soluble dans l'eau qui sert d'\u00e9paississant, de liant, de stabilisateur ou de filmog\u00e8ne dans toutes sortes de produits, du dentifrice \u00e0 la cr\u00e8me glac\u00e9e en passant par le ciment et la c\u00e9ramique.<\/p>\t\t\t\t\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<div class=\"elementor-element elementor-element-ffa592a elementor-widget elementor-widget-heading\" data-id=\"ffa592a\" data-element_type=\"widget\" data-settings=\"{&quot;ekit_we_effect_on&quot;:&quot;none&quot;}\" data-widget_type=\"heading.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t<h3 class=\"elementor-heading-title elementor-size-default\">2.PAC<\/h3>\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<div class=\"elementor-element elementor-element-8905f46 elementor-widget elementor-widget-text-editor\" data-id=\"8905f46\" data-element_type=\"widget\" data-settings=\"{&quot;ekit_we_effect_on&quot;:&quot;none&quot;}\" data-widget_type=\"text-editor.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t\t\t\t\t<p><b>PAC, ou cellulose polyanionique,<\/b> est chimiquement tr\u00e8s proche de la CMC. En fait, elle est souvent consid\u00e9r\u00e9e comme une version de haute puret\u00e9 et de haute performance de la CMC. Elle est produite selon la m\u00eame m\u00e9thode g\u00e9n\u00e9rale, mais sous un contr\u00f4le de processus plus strict, en utilisant un \u00e9quipement plus avanc\u00e9 et des techniques de formulation optimis\u00e9es.<\/p>\t\t\t\t\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<div class=\"elementor-element elementor-element-e283b88 elementor-widget elementor-widget-text-editor\" data-id=\"e283b88\" data-element_type=\"widget\" data-settings=\"{&quot;ekit_we_effect_on&quot;:&quot;none&quot;}\" data-widget_type=\"text-editor.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t\t\t\t\t<p>Le r\u00e9sultat est un mat\u00e9riau avec une substitution plus uniforme, une meilleure r\u00e9sistance au sel et une stabilit\u00e9 am\u00e9lior\u00e9e, en particulier dans les environnements difficiles.<\/p>\t\t\t\t\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<div class=\"elementor-element elementor-element-322256b elementor-widget elementor-widget-heading\" data-id=\"322256b\" data-element_type=\"widget\" data-settings=\"{&quot;ekit_we_effect_on&quot;:&quot;none&quot;}\" data-widget_type=\"heading.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t<h2 class=\"elementor-heading-title elementor-size-default\">II. Une chimie similaire, des performances diff\u00e9rentes<\/h2>\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<div class=\"elementor-element elementor-element-613bb56 elementor-widget elementor-widget-text-editor\" data-id=\"613bb56\" data-element_type=\"widget\" data-settings=\"{&quot;ekit_we_effect_on&quot;:&quot;none&quot;}\" data-widget_type=\"text-editor.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t\t\t\t\t<p>D'un point de vue strictement chimique, <b>Le PAC est un type de CMC<\/b>. Toutefois, plusieurs diff\u00e9rences essentielles d\u00e9coulent de la mani\u00e8re dont ils sont fabriqu\u00e9s :<\/p>\t\t\t\t\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<div class=\"elementor-element elementor-element-e912717 elementor-widget elementor-widget-heading\" data-id=\"e912717\" data-element_type=\"widget\" data-settings=\"{&quot;ekit_we_effect_on&quot;:&quot;none&quot;}\" data-widget_type=\"heading.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t<h3 class=\"elementor-heading-title elementor-size-default\">1. l'uniformit\u00e9 de la substitution<\/h3>\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<div class=\"elementor-element elementor-element-aa68484 elementor-widget elementor-widget-text-editor\" data-id=\"aa68484\" data-element_type=\"widget\" data-settings=\"{&quot;ekit_we_effect_on&quot;:&quot;none&quot;}\" data-widget_type=\"text-editor.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t\t\t\t\t<p>La performance de l'\u00e9ther de cellulose d\u00e9pend largement de la distribution uniforme des groupes carboxym\u00e9thyles sur la cha\u00eene de cellulose. Les PAC ont un degr\u00e9 de substitution plus \u00e9lev\u00e9 et plus uniforme, ce qui se traduit par une meilleure solubilit\u00e9 dans l'eau et des performances plus stables en solution.<\/p>\t\t\t\t\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<div class=\"elementor-element elementor-element-00f1c6f elementor-widget elementor-widget-heading\" data-id=\"00f1c6f\" data-element_type=\"widget\" data-settings=\"{&quot;ekit_we_effect_on&quot;:&quot;none&quot;}\" data-widget_type=\"heading.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t<h3 class=\"elementor-heading-title elementor-size-default\">2.R\u00e9sistance aux sels et aux hautes temp\u00e9ratures<\/h3>\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<div class=\"elementor-element elementor-element-d215cb2 elementor-widget elementor-widget-text-editor\" data-id=\"d215cb2\" data-element_type=\"widget\" data-settings=\"{&quot;ekit_we_effect_on&quot;:&quot;none&quot;}\" data-widget_type=\"text-editor.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t\t\t\t\t<p><b>PAC<\/b> ont une excellente r\u00e9sistance aux sels et aux temp\u00e9ratures \u00e9lev\u00e9es, ce qui les rend adapt\u00e9s aux fluides de forage p\u00e9trolier et \u00e0 d'autres applications exigeantes. <b>CMC<\/b>Bien qu'il soit efficace dans les syst\u00e8mes d'eau douce, il a tendance \u00e0 donner de mauvais r\u00e9sultats dans les environnements \u00e0 forte salinit\u00e9 ou \u00e0 forte chaleur.<\/p>\t\t\t\t\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<div class=\"elementor-element elementor-element-d85e5e1 elementor-widget elementor-widget-heading\" data-id=\"d85e5e1\" data-element_type=\"widget\" data-settings=\"{&quot;ekit_we_effect_on&quot;:&quot;none&quot;}\" data-widget_type=\"heading.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t<h3 class=\"elementor-heading-title elementor-size-default\">3. puret\u00e9 et coh\u00e9rence<\/h3>\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<div class=\"elementor-element elementor-element-5fc3dd0 elementor-widget elementor-widget-text-editor\" data-id=\"5fc3dd0\" data-element_type=\"widget\" data-settings=\"{&quot;ekit_we_effect_on&quot;:&quot;none&quot;}\" data-widget_type=\"text-editor.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t\t\t\t\t<p>Les PAC sont fabriqu\u00e9s selon des normes de puret\u00e9 plus \u00e9lev\u00e9es, avec moins d'impuret\u00e9s et une distribution plus uniforme du poids mol\u00e9culaire. Il en r\u00e9sulte une variabilit\u00e9 moindre d'un lot \u00e0 l'autre et un meilleur contr\u00f4le de la viscosit\u00e9, de la perte de fluide et du comportement rh\u00e9ologique.<\/p>\t\t\t\t\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<div class=\"elementor-element elementor-element-c71f5de elementor-widget elementor-widget-heading\" data-id=\"c71f5de\" data-element_type=\"widget\" data-settings=\"{&quot;ekit_we_effect_on&quot;:&quot;none&quot;}\" data-widget_type=\"heading.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t<h2 class=\"elementor-heading-title elementor-size-default\">Comparaison des spectres FTIR : Un examen plus approfondi<\/h2>\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<div class=\"elementor-element elementor-element-1aa19ab elementor-widget elementor-widget-image\" data-id=\"1aa19ab\" data-element_type=\"widget\" data-settings=\"{&quot;ekit_we_effect_on&quot;:&quot;none&quot;}\" data-widget_type=\"image.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t\t\t\t\t\t\t\t\t\t\t<img decoding=\"async\" width=\"800\" height=\"567\" src=\"https:\/\/tenessy.com\/wp-content\/uploads\/2025\/07\/Infrared_spectra_of_CMC_and_PAC.webp\" class=\"attachment-full size-full wp-image-12608\" alt=\"\" srcset=\"https:\/\/tenessy.com\/wp-content\/uploads\/2025\/07\/Infrared_spectra_of_CMC_and_PAC.webp 800w, https:\/\/tenessy.com\/wp-content\/uploads\/2025\/07\/Infrared_spectra_of_CMC_and_PAC-300x213.webp 300w, https:\/\/tenessy.com\/wp-content\/uploads\/2025\/07\/Infrared_spectra_of_CMC_and_PAC-768x544.webp 768w, https:\/\/tenessy.com\/wp-content\/uploads\/2025\/07\/Infrared_spectra_of_CMC_and_PAC-18x12.webp 18w\" sizes=\"(max-width: 800px) 100vw, 800px\" \/>\t\t\t\t\t\t\t\t\t\t\t\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<div class=\"elementor-element elementor-element-8652bbd elementor-widget elementor-widget-text-editor\" data-id=\"8652bbd\" data-element_type=\"widget\" data-settings=\"{&quot;ekit_we_effect_on&quot;:&quot;none&quot;}\" data-widget_type=\"text-editor.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t\t\t\t\t<p>En utilisant la spectroscopie infrarouge pour analyser qualitativement les structures de la CMC et du PAC, on peut constater que les pics de vibration caract\u00e9ristiques du PAC et de la CMC sont extr\u00eamement similaires et que les hauteurs des pics sont fondamentalement les m\u00eames.<\/p>\t\t\t\t\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<div class=\"elementor-element elementor-element-d2c8efd elementor-widget elementor-widget-heading\" data-id=\"d2c8efd\" data-element_type=\"widget\" data-settings=\"{&quot;ekit_we_effect_on&quot;:&quot;none&quot;}\" data-widget_type=\"heading.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t<h2 class=\"elementor-heading-title elementor-size-default\">IV.
